Suzanne H. Sandridge (nee Holthaus), of Saint Charles, MO, passed away Monday, March 9, 2020 at the age of 77. Beloved wife of 55 wonderful years to Jack Sandridge; cherished daughter of the late John and Miriam “Peep” Holthaus (nee Achelpohl); devoted mother of Jon (Hideko Nishihara) Sandridge, Ph.D., Rich Sandridge; loving grandmother of Misaki Sandridge-Nishihara and Takumi Sandridge-Nishihara; dear sister of Christine (Richard) Warner; treasured aunt of Sarah (Steve) Fort and Phillip (Tiffany) Warner.
Suzanne was a longtime member of Our Savior Lutheran Church, where she was also active in the Choir. Suzanne was a longtime educator as well, having spent many years of her life teaching in Mokane, MO and in the St. Charles School District. She divided her years there between Willie Harris where she taught 1
st grade, Our Savior Lutheran Church Preschool, Lindenwood Kindergarten, and served as an Elementary Substitute teacher of the St. Charles School District. Suzanne was a Cub Scout Den Mother and Den Leader Coach when her boys were young, and in her free time she enjoyed quilting. One of her proudest achievements, however, was her generous twenty year service to the St. Louis Zoo as a Docent, where she was fondly known as the “Snail Lady.” Suzanne was very outgoing, happy, and so friendly that she never met a stranger. She was dearly loved and will be greatly missed by all who knew her.
